Output de70de86cfd8d305796c367623829588e69cb65cc879ed123dd188a45277386b:0

value
3806805
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44b4e65654a9d7f4ecf2282398f61b1d884c0e71 OP_EQUALVERIFY OP_CHECKSIG
address
17GHfBRo1BwNeBB6kgwTdUCMbiZHn9CFW7
transaction
de70de86cfd8d305796c367623829588e69cb65cc879ed123dd188a45277386b
spent
true